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
[A particle of] debris in space resulting from collisions among asteroids, comets, moons, and planets. 2, record 1, English, - meteoroid
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 OBS
When [a meteoroid] enters the earth's atmosphere it is heated to luminosity and becomes a meteor. 3, record 1, English, - meteoroid
